#81544e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81544e is composed of 50.6% red, 32.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 39.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 7.1 degrees, a saturation of 24.6% and a lightness of 40.6%. #81544e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a89c with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#81544e color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#81544e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#81544e has RGB values of R:129, G:84,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.4,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8475726.

Shades and Tints of #81544e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070404 is the darkest color, while #fcf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#81544e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696666 is the less saturated color, while #c91d06 is the most saturated one.
